Dedicated Workflow Workers for Performance Booster and Performance Booster Elite
Zuora Workflow automates complex business processes at scale. Dedicated Workflow Workers ensure high-priority jobs run reliably with reduced queue times.
Zuora Workflow enables you to automate critical business processes. As business processes scale up in complexity and volume, Workflow operates with optimized routines to enable orchestrations to grow without any technical system and infrastructural impediments.
When initiated, workflows are placed in a global queue across all Zuora tenants to run as soon as processing power becomes available. The global queue is sufficient because the workflow generally begins execution within minutes. For top-priority workflow operations, where processing within a specified timeframe is critical, Zuora Dedicated Workflow Workers provide always-available resources that can be called upon without interference from other competing business processes.
Dedicated Workers reduce queue time for high-priority jobs and provide consistency in wait period lengths. Cutting down variable wait time better equips you to confidently support just-in-time and near-real-time workflows.
Workflow queue size mitigation tactics
You can manage Workflow queue size by assigning priority with careful consideration and continually monitoring the Workflow System Health Dashboard for any indicators and trends that surface long queue periods.
You must assign workflows as low, medium, and high priorities. Assigning all workflows to high priority does not produce any enhanced performance. If you ensure that asynchronous and batch jobs are in lower execution priority, then mission-critical flows have precedence.
